#1b9183 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b9183 is composed of 10.6% red, 56.9%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.7%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 172.9 degrees, a saturation of 68.6% and a lightness of 33.7%. #1b9183 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ffff with #002307.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#1b9183
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020d0b is the darkest color, while #fbfefe is the lightest one.
